52004716414224666618
Barcode
Even
52004716414224666618 is even
Previous even number is 52004716414224666616
Next even number is 52004716414224666620
Cubed
140646263022447259806692569243241254223093601291945072181032
Squared
Hexadecimal
Binary
101101000110110101110111100000101111000010110010011000111111111010